Historical Events on August 15

1281 Mongol invasion of Japan: The Mongolian fleet of Kublai Khan is destroyed by a "divine wind" for the second time in the Battle of Kōan.
1070 The Pavian-born Benedictine Lanfranc is appointed as the new Archbishop of Canterbury in England.
1995 Tomiichi Murayama, Prime Minister of Japan, releases the Murayama Statement, which formally expresses remorse for Japanese war crimes committed during World War II.
1944 World War II: Operation Dragoon: Allied forces land in southern France.
1760 Seven Years' War: Battle of Liegnitz: Frederick the Great's victory over the Austrians under Ernst Gideon von Laudon.
1057 King Macbeth is killed at the Battle of Lumphanan by the forces of Máel Coluim mac Donnchada.
1038 King Stephen I, the first king of Hungary, dies; his nephew, Peter Orseolo, succeeds him.
1945 Emperor Hirohito broadcasts his declaration of surrender following the effective surrender of Japan in World War II; Korea gains independence from the Empire of Japan.
1599 Nine Years' War: Battle of Curlew Pass: Irish forces led by Hugh Roe O'Donnell successfully ambush English forces, led by Sir Conyers Clifford, sent to relieve Collooney Castle.
1975 Bangladeshi leader Sheikh Mujibur Rahman is killed along with most members of his family during a military coup.
